A new, authentic collection of Captain Cook's voyages round the World, undertaken by order of his present Majesty, for making new discoveries, &c. &c. His first. -Undertaken and performed in the Endeavour, in the years 1768, 1769, 1770, and 1771, for observing the Transit of Venus, and making Discoveries in the Southern Hemisphere, &c. His second. - In the Resolution and Adventure, in the years 1772, 1773, 1774, and 1775, for making further Discoveries towards the South Pole, and round the World. His third and last. - In the Resolution and Discovery, to the Pacific Ocean, in the years 1776, 1777, 1778, 1779, and 1780, for making new Discoveries in the Northern Hemisphere, &c. Comprehending the Life and Death of Captain Cook. Together with Capt. Furneaux's Narrative in the Adventure, during the Separation of the Ships in the second Voyage, during which Period several of his People were destroyed by the Natives of Queen Charlotte's Sound. Written by several principal officers, and other gentlemen who sailed in the various ships.
